Output 8c66ac203e18dfc1a04dabfb5069f5439d1b8f590008998be152fe553f798fe2:17

value
721102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18057fe9d719186323f22cecad736c621ebf68f6 OP_EQUAL
address
33t2jGfXU2NGmMsTqLS8qsRh1ouDfWeUev
transaction
8c66ac203e18dfc1a04dabfb5069f5439d1b8f590008998be152fe553f798fe2